Commit Message

Anthony PERARD Sept. 13, 2019, 2:50 p.m. UTC
When doing an action with a path and subpath in the xenstore,
XenStoreJoin is called to generate "$path/$subpath". But this function
do an allocation of memory which isn't necessary. Instead we will
construct the path with WRITE_REQUEST and data used to generate the
path will be copied directly to the xenstore shared ring.

Also change WRITE_REQUEST.Len type, it only contain sizes and doesn't
need to be exactly 32bits.
